To find a number between 55 and 101 that is a multiple of 6, 9, and 18, you need to find the least common multiple (LCM) of those three numbers.

Step 1: Find the LCM of 6 and 9.
The multiples of 6 are: 6, 12, 18, 24, 30, 36, 42, 48, 54, 60, 66, 72, 78, 84, 90, 96, and so on.
The multiples of 9 are: 9, 18, 27, 36, 45, 54, 63, 72, 81, 90, 99, and so on.

From the lists above, we can see that the LCM of 6 and 9 is 18.

Step 2: Find the LCM of 18 and 18.
The multiples of 18 are: 18, 36, 54, 72, 90, and so on.

From the list above, we can see that the LCM of 18 and 18 is 18.

Therefore, the LCM of 6, 9, and 18 is 18.

Now, we need to find a number between 55 and 101 that is a multiple of 18.

The multiples of 18 between 55 and 101 are: 72 and 90.

Therefore, Milan can choose either 72 or 90 as a number between 55 and 101 that is a multiple of 6, 9, and 18.
